A-B US Shipments -10.1%, Depletions -13.7% in Q1, Final Quarter Before Boycott Comps
Brewbound
by Zoe Licata
7h ago
Anheuser-Busch InBev’s (A-B) U.S. businesses recorded double-digit shipments and depletions declines in Q1, the final quarter before the company begins to lap initial accelerated declines from the conservative-led boycott of Bud Light that began in April 2023 ..read more

Craft Declines Accelerate Through Late April; A Look at Price Swings in Circana Scans
Brewbound
by Justin Kendall
1d ago
Craft beer scans declined -3% in the four-week period ending April 21 in multi-outlet and convenience stores, tracked by market research firm Circana. Volume, measured in case sales, tumbled -4.7% in the period, the firm added ..read more
